Riyadh-based AviLease reported 2025 revenue of $664 million, up 19% year-on-year, with pre-tax earnings doubling to $122 million. The lessor expanded to 202 aircraft serving over 50 airlines in 30+ countries, reaching $9.3 billion in assets.
